Sport in brief with Jamie J: April 25, 2025

WOMEN’S FOOTBALL: Nine-time Scottish Cup winners Glasgow City take on Motherwell in tomorrow’s first semi-final before holders Rangers are up against Aberdeen on Sunday. Both matches will be taking place at Hampden Park. Rangers currently sit second in the Women’s Premier League, one point ahead of third-placed Glasgow City while Motherwell are sixth and Aberdeen eighth. The final will take place on the last weekend in May.

SPEEDWAY: Jason Doyle top-scored with 11+1 points as Ipswich Witches thrashed Birmingham 60-30 on Thursday evening to maintain their 100 per cent record and move five points clear at the top of the Premiership. Birmingham are yet to pick up a win and sit second bottom, one place ahead of Oxford who slumped to a heavy 33-57 defeat at Sheffield. Chris Holder top-scored for Sheffield with 13+1 points from five rides.

DARTS: Gerwyn Price beat Luke Humphries 6-4 in Thursday’s Premier League final in Liverpool to move third in the table, trailing league leader Luke Littler by 10 points and sitting six behind second-placed Humphries. Littler let slip a 4-0 lead to lose 6-5 against Michael van Gerwen in the first round while bottom of the table Stephen Bunting went down 6-1 to Rob Cross in his opening match. Birmingham hosts next week’s round.
